Output 66c37a51a2a768f846d7514014cafc10ba72ebbadde31647920cf24ee678ebdb:0

value
339160400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40bc2c149cd0d63dc7b1c32647e5e56d607d5f5 OP_EQUAL
address
MQK9x7S5znQgPuQ1jMtKBYBeWAa3cVDLjY
transaction
66c37a51a2a768f846d7514014cafc10ba72ebbadde31647920cf24ee678ebdb
spent
true